Perhaps we're not talking about the same thing.  That should set the font
in the non-UTF-8 case for xterm.  But uxterm is setting environment and
options so that (I am fighting with PuTTY again ;-):

        UXTerm.vt100.utf8Fonts.font

is the corresponding resource which is expected to have an iso10646 font.
xterm will work with that - if you're not using any characters past the
iso-8859-1 set.  The cells corresponding to missing characters should be
blank.
